Position Summary:

The Program Coordinator supports individuals we serve in residential/day service settings. They must be a passionate leader who can successfully assist in directing supervisors and support staff to provide high quality services to individuals we support. In addition to ensuring the overall health and safety of the people we support, the Program Coordinator also ensures the effective and efficient use of available resources and will follow through with all job duties consistent with the agency mission, vision, and values.

Responsibilities

Operations & Administration

- Oversee scheduling, staffing coverage, and on-call coordination
- Ensure compliance with licensing, safety, and regulatory requirements
- Maintain accurate documentation (reports, incidents, case files)
- Develop and adjust service strategies based on individual progress
- Monitor program effectiveness through consistent communication with stakeholders
- Report concerns, risks, and required changes to senior leadership
- Direct supervisors and support staff in delivering structured, person-centered services
- Translate individual plans into daily service execution and measurable outcomes
- Identify service gaps and implement corrective actions

Staff Leadership

- Conduct performance reviews and address performance or conduct issues
- Provide ongoing training and real-time support to frontline teams
- Assist in the recruitment, hiring,



training, supervision, coordination and performance of Direct Support staff and Managers

Requirements

Experience

- Minimum of 3 years' experience in a leadership role managing staff is required
- Experience handling staff performance, conflict, and service delivery issues
- Background in community services, healthcare, or residential support is an asset

Education

- Bachelor’s degree in a related field is preferred
- Equivalent combination of education and experience will be considered

Qualifications and Skills

- Explicit decision-making in fast-moving environments
- Strong communication (written and verbal)
- Ability to manage competing priorities without losing structure
- Practical problem-solving and sound judgment

Additional Requirements

- Valid Class 5F Manitoba driver’s license
- Access to a reliable vehicle
- Availability for evenings, weekends, and on-call rotation
